DEPARTMENT OF ENERGY


Environmental Management Site-Specific Advisory Board, Monticello 
Site

AGENCY: Department of Energy.

ACTION: Notice of open meeting.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: This notice announces a meeting of the Environmental 
Management Site-Specific Advisory Board (EM SSAB), Monticello. The 
Federal Advisory Committee Act (Pub. L. No. 92-463, 86 Stat. 770) 
requires that public notice of these meetings be announced in the 
Federal Register.

Date and Time: Wednesday, June 16, 1999, 7:00 p.m.-9:00 p.m.

Addresses: San Juan County Courthouse, 2nd Floor Conference Room, 117 
South Main, Monticello, Utah 84535.

FOR FURTHER INFORMATION CONTACT: Audrey Berry, Public Affairs 
Specialist, Department of Energy Grand Junction Projects Office, P.O. 
Box 2567, Grand Junction, CO 81502, (303) 248-7727.

S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ION:
    Purpose of the Board: The purpose of the Board is to advise DOE and 
its regulators in the areas of environmental restoration, waste 
management, and related activities.
Tentative Agenda:
    1. The Board will receive updates on the repository status.
    2. The Board will discuss the Monticello surface and groundwater.
    3. The Committee will receive updates and reports from 
subcommittees on local training and hiring, health and safety, and 
future land use.
    Public Participation: The meeting is open to the public. Written 
statements may be filed with the Committee either before or after the 
meeting. Individuals who wish to make oral statements pertaining to 
agenda items should contact Audrey Berry's office at the address or 
telephone number listed above. Requests must be received 5 days prior 
to the meeting and reasonable provision will be made to include the 
presentation in the agenda. The Deputy Designated Federal Officer is 
empowered to conduct the meeting in a fashion that will facilitate the 
orderly conduct of business. Each individual wishing to make public 
comment will be provided a maximum of 5 minutes to present their 
comments at the end of the meeting. This notice is being published less 
than 15 days before the date of the meeting due to programmatic issues 
that had to be resolved prior to publication.
